200px-Seal_of_Michigan_svgLast month, the Michigan Department of Treasury will begin to process current-year Sales, Use, and Withholding (SUW) tax returns with a new online system. As a result of this new processing system, there will be changes to the SUW forms and to the way taxpayers can file and make payments for tax year 2015 returns.

The new bundle of e-services is called Michigan Treasury Online (MTO). SUW taxpayers will have 24/7 access to their accounts, and will be able to file returns and make payments electronically in one convenient transaction.
